Sorts Of Roofing Products



When it pertains to selecting roof covering products, you'll find a variety of alternatives, each with unique benefits and drawbacks.


Asphalt roof shingles are a popular choice due to their affordability and simplicity of installation. They come in numerous colors and designs, making it basic to match your home's visual. Nevertheless, they mightn't be the most durable alternative in severe climate condition.

Steel roof, on the other hand, supplies exceptional durability and weather resistance. It's light-weight and can reflect sunlight, which may help reduce power expenses. While the ahead of time price can be greater, you'll benefit from its toughness in the future.

If you're seeking a green choice, take into consideration slate or clay tiles. They're exceptionally resilient and can last for over a century. Nevertheless, remember that they require a solid architectural assistance due to their weight, and installation can be extra complicated.

Lastly, there's wood roofing, usually made from cedar or redwood. It offers a stunning, natural look yet calls for normal upkeep to prevent rot and insect damage.

Inevitably, your selection needs to straighten with your budget, visual choices, and the certain environment in your location.

Price Comparison of Products



Normally, property owners find that the cost of roof products varies dramatically based on the type you choose. Asphalt shingles tend to be one of the most affordable choice, costing around $90 to $100 per square. They're commonly offered and reasonably simple to set up, making them a popular selection.

For a premium choice, slate roofing can cost anywhere from $600 to $1,500 per square, providing phenomenal durability and aesthetic appeal. However, this comes with a large price, and installation can be labor-intensive.

Inevitably, it's important to balance your budget with the durability and maintenance needs of each product. Spending wisely currently can save you cash over time, so ensure to assess both your present economic scenario and future requirements prior to making a decision.

Variables to Think About When Picking



Picking the ideal roof product entails a number of crucial factors beyond simply cost.

First, consider your neighborhood environment. If you live in an area with hefty rainfall or snow, you'll want a product that can withstand these conditions. Asphalt shingles may work well in moderate climates, however steel or slate could be much better for harsher environments.

Next off, think of the life expectancy of the material. Some roof covering choices, like metal and ceramic tile, can last 50 years or more, while asphalt tiles commonly last around twenty years. A longer life expectancy might save you cash over time, even if the in advance cost is higher.

Also, evaluate the aesthetic charm. Your roof substantially affects your home's visual appeal, so pick a style and shade that matches your design.

Don't forget about energy performance. Some materials show sunlight and can help reduce cooling down expenses, which is a big plus during hot summertimes.

Last but not least, inspect regional building ordinance and policies. Some areas have restrictions on specific materials, so it's important to study prior to making a decision.
